# Merle Monte's Sea-Scraper
This 1888 serialized adventure story by Col. Prentiss Ingraham follows Merle Monte, a condemned U.S. Navy midshipman, and his Abyssinian slave Mezrak, held prisoner aboard the pirate vessel of Brandt, the Buccaneer. Brandt seeks to force them to reveal the location of their hidden Treasure Island, which contains wealth inherited from Merle's grandfather Freelance (a buccaneer) and a Persian princess's dowry. The narrative reveals that Black Diamond, the ship's pilot, is actually a disguised avenger working against Brandt. After rescuing Merle's navigation chart and claiming to know the island's location, Black Diamond secures the prisoners on deck, apparently to witness Brandt's triumph as the vessel approaches the island during an approaching storm.
